编程控制班学什么
-
编程控制班主要学习的内容包括以下几方面:
1.编程语言基础:学习一门或多门编程语言的基本语法、数据类型、控制结构、函数等。常见的编程语言有Python、Java、C++等,选择适合自己的编程语言进行学习。
2.数据结构与算法:学习常见的数据结构,如数组、链表、栈、队列、树、图等,以及算法的设计与分析方法。掌握数据结构与算法可以提高编程的效率和代码的质量。
3.面向对象编程:学习面向对象的编程思想和相关的概念,如类、对象、继承、多态等。面向对象编程可以更好地组织和管理代码,提高代码的可重用性和可扩展性。
4.软件工程与开发实践:学习软件开发的基本流程和工具,如需求分析、设计、编码、测试、部署等。了解软件开发的方法和规范,提高项目管理和团队协作能力。
5.数据库基础:学习数据库的设计和管理,如SQL语言的基本操作、关系型数据库的原理和应用。掌握数据库可以存储和管理大量的数据,提供数据查询和处理的能力。
6.网络编程:学习网络通信的基本原理和编程技术,如Socket编程、HTTP协议等。了解网络编程可以实现网络应用和服务端的开发。
7.实际项目实践:通过实际的项目案例,学习如何应用所学的知识进行实际的开发。通过实践可以加深对编程的理解和掌握,并培养解决问题的能力。
编程控制班的学习内容主要是培养学员的编程思维和实际应用能力,使其具备独立开发、解决问题的能力。学员可以通过不断的练习和实践,逐步提升自己的编程水平,成为一名优秀的程序员。
1年前 -
编程控制班主要学习以下内容:
-
编程语言:学习一种或多种编程语言,如Python、Java、C++等。掌握编程语言的语法、数据类型、控制结构等基本概念和技巧,能够编写简单的程序。
-
数据结构与算法:学习常用的数据结构,如数组、链表、栈、队列、树等,以及基本的算法设计与分析方法,如排序、搜索、图算法等。掌握数据结构和算法的基本原理和使用方法,能够选择适当的数据结构和算法解决实际问题。
-
软件开发工具和方法:学习使用软件开发工具,如集成开发环境(IDE)和版本控制工具,以及常用的软件开发方法和流程,如需求分析、系统设计、编码、测试等。培养良好的编码风格和软件工程思维,能够进行团队合作和项目管理。
-
网络编程与数据库:学习网络编程的基本原理和技术,如HTTP、TCP/IP协议,以及常用的网络编程库和框架。学习数据库的基本概念和操作方法,如SQL语句的编写和数据库的设计和管理。能够开发基于网络的应用和访问数据库的程序。
-
前端开发和后端开发:学习前端开发的基本技术,如HTML/CSS、JavaScript,以及前端框架和工具,如React、Vue、Webpack等。学习后端开发的基本技术,如Web框架、数据库访问、API设计等。能够开发具有交互性和动态特性的Web应用。
编程控制班还可能学习其他相关内容,如面向对象编程、软件测试、人工智能、大数据分析等。最终目标是培养学员的编程能力和解决实际问题的能力,为其今后从事软件开发、系统维护等工作打下良好的基础。
1年前 -
-
编程控制班是一种培训班,旨在教授学生计算机编程的基础知识和技能。在编程控制班中,学生将学习如何使用编程语言编写代码,以实现特定的功能和任务。下面是一个关于编程控制班学习内容的示例,内容结构如下:
- 简介
- 编程控制班的定义和目的
- 学习编程的重要性
- 基础知识
- 计算机基础概念:如二进制、计算机组成部分等
- 软件和硬件的区别与联系
- 编程语言的分类和选择
- 编程语言入门
- 基本编程概念:变量、数据类型、运算符等
- 控制流程:条件语句、循环语句等
- 函数和模块化编程
- 数据结构和算法
- 数组和列表操作
- 链表、栈、队列等常见数据结构
- 常见算法:排序、查找、递归等
- 应用开发
- 用户界面设计和交互操作
- 数据处理和存储
- 错误处理和调试技巧
- 开发工具和环境设置
- 开发集成环境(IDE)的选择和使用
- 调试工具的使用和故障排除
- 版本控制和代码管理
- 实践项目
- 实际应用项目的开发和实现
- 团队合作和项目管理
- 持续学习和知识更新
通过以上内容的学习,学生能够掌握基本的计算机编程概念和技能,并能够运用所学的知识解决实际问题。编程控制班的教学方法通常包括讲座、实践,以及小组项目等。学生将通过编写代码、调试错误、独立解决问题等方式来提升自己的编程能力。此外,教师还会为学生提供反馈和指导,以帮助他们不断改进,并鼓励他们参与编程社区和开源项目,加强与其他开发者的交流与合作。编程控制班的学习内容是丰富多样的,涵盖了编程的各个方面,旨在为学生打下坚实的编程基础,培养其创造性思维和解决问题的能力。
1年前